The women’s soccer coaches at Ocean State University want to practice late at night the next few days because of the excessive heat.    Since this is the preseason practice period, is it permissible for the team to be on the field from 9pm to 1am?

No.  NCAA Bylaw 17.1.7.9.5 states that countable athletically related activities shall not occur between midnight and 5 a.m.

There is not a legislative exception for preseason practice.  The institution could certainly file a waiver and include any mitigating factors for needing to practice during that time period
